RICHMOND, Va. –

People in Virginia who lost their homes because SunTrust Bank foreclosed on them could be eligible for payment, under a $550 million SunTrust national mortgage foreclosure settlement.

There are approximately 3,050 qualified borrowers who lost their homes between January 1, 2008 and December 31, 2013.

They’re urged to respond and get a packet from Attorney General Mark Herring that includes a one-page claim form. That form must be returned by June 4th.

The AG’s office says SunTrust agreed to a $550 million national settlement with the federal government, Commonwealth of Virginia, 48 other states, and the District of Columbia after investigations alleging numerous violations in its servicing of mortgages and its foreclosure practices.
